## Further reading

If you're reviewing a migration PR on Copperline, please skim our zero-downtime playbook first. The short version: expand, backfill, switch, contract — never drop or rename a column in the same release that stops writing to it. Most review pushback we get is about skipping the backfill verification step, so look for that checklist in the PR description. The full playbook, with worked examples and the gotchas we've hit twice now, lives on the internal page below.

dashboard of yafog-fajof = https://jira.tolvaqsys.internal/pages/pages/projects/49fe21c4

Meeting notes — Signalfold dedup review. We walked through how the alert deduplicator collapses repeated pages from the Quillhook probes. Current fingerprint uses alert title plus cluster tag, which merges distinct disk and memory alerts on shared hosts. Agreed to extend the fingerprint with the check identifier and add a 10-minute decay window so stale groups reopen cleanly. Future maintainers should test against the replay corpus before changing hashing. Final approval of the new fingerprint scheme rests with one owner.

account owner for bawip-tahag: Raleth Quenok

## Handover — Flaky DNS on Mistral Gateway

Hey — passing this one to you before I'm out. The Mistral gateway intermittently fails to resolve the upstream billing host; retries mask it, but every few hours a burst of timeouts sneaks through. Pretty sure it's the resolver cache TTL fighting with the internal zone refresh. I bumped logging on the resolver sidecar so you'll see misses clearly. Current resolver settings on the affected pods are below.

config for kafof-bawef:
holath:
  log_level: debug
  metrics_host: metrics.holath.qorvelsys.internal
  pin: 2191
  pool_size: 32

Welcome to Ferrowpay on-call. Quick note on payment retries: every retry must reuse the original idempotency key, or the Marrick gateway will double-charge. Keys live 48 hours; retries past that window require manual review, never an automated resend. If you see duplicate-charge alerts, check key reuse first. Full procedure is on the internal page here.

operations page: https://jira.qorvelsys.internal/browse/pages/browse/pages